What a pricing page leaves out

Shared or dedicated changes everything

An address you share carries the reputation of everyone else on it. That is acceptable for some work and fatal for anything involving a login. The price difference between shared and dedicated usually reflects exactly this.

Who pays for the requests that fail

On a hard target, failures are the majority of your traffic. Whether those failures are billed decides the real cost, and the clause covering it is rarely on the pricing page.

The limit that stops the job

Rate limits are often enforced per account rather than per plan, which means buying more traffic does not raise them. Confirm how yours scales before you assume a bigger plan runs faster.

The measurement that outranks every review

This costs less than a coffee and produces the only evidence that applies to your workload.

  1. Put a few dollars on each account. Trials are fine for a first look, but paid traffic is what you will actually be buying.
  2. Run them against the site you actually care about, using the code you actually run, within the same hour.
  3. Track the success rate and the bandwidth. A cheap gigabyte that fails half the time is not cheap.
  4. Run a sample of the addresses through an independent lookup, because advertised geography and actual geography differ more often than the market admits.
  5. Keep the winner, and repeat the whole thing quarterly, because pools age.

How do I compare two providers fairly?
Match the units first, because residential is billed per gigabyte, datacenter and ISP per address, and mobile per day or per port. Then compare the rate you can actually reach today rather than the volume tier behind a commitment. Finish by measuring the success rate on your own target, since a cheap request that fails costs more than a dearer one that works.
Is a cheaper provider usually worse?
Not reliably. Price in this market reflects the supply model and the sales overhead as much as the network. What price does not tell you is the success rate on your target, and that is the figure that decides whether the cheaper option was cheap or expensive. Measure before assuming either way.
Does a bigger pool mean better results?
No. Your job meets only the exits it draws, in the countries it needs, against one target's defences. Freshness and rotation policy move the outcome far more than the headline total, and pool totals across this market are counted generously and rarely audited.
